abstract="Recent changes in attitudes concerning medical equipment maintenance place more responsibility for planning appropriate levels of maintenance on the clinical engineer and biomedical equipment technician. A system is described in which maintenance decisions are based on the effects of equipment failure on quality of patient care and potential for injury to patients and staff. It is hoped that development of an acceptable classification scheme will simplify maintenance decisions. Such a system will provide levels of maintenance appropriate to the equipment function in patient care.<p /><p>Language: en</p>",
